Actor Kavi Kumar Azad, who played Dr Hansraj Hathi's role in Sab TV's popular show '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ah' passed away on Monday morning after suffering a cardiac arrest. He breathed his last at Mumbai’s Wockhardt Hospital.

He was an integral part of 'Taarak Mehta..' that recently made it to Guinness Book of World Records for ‘airing the highest number of episodes’ on television, both original and repeat. He had been playing Dr Haathi's role since eight years. Kavi had replaced actor Nirmal Soni, who played the role for a year since the show begun, in 2009. 

In the show, he was shown to be an overweight doctor from Uttar Pradesh who lived with his wife Komal and son Gulabkumar (Goli). He was a funny man who used to think and talk about food all day.

Not many know that apart from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ah, Kavi Kumar Azad had also appeared in episode two of the season one of Disney Channel's show 'Best of Luck Nikki' in the role of Jaanbaz Jaadugar. Had had worn a typical blue and red superman costume in the episode.

In 2013, he played the role of one of the 10-century guards in Gulshan Grover starrer 'Fun2shh… Dudes in the 10th Century.'

He also reportedly had a small role in Aamir Khan and Twinkle Khanna's 2000 film, 'Mela.'
